Since I was cleared by the doctor last week to run, I just haven't had any motivation to get out.  When I got an email from Jun earlier in the week saying the boys were heading out to Antelope Island for a run, I knew it's what I needed to get mojo back.

I met up with Dorsimus, Scott, and Jun out on the island.  They were planning on doing a 50K and I was only planning on 15 or so since my ankle is still only about 70%.  We all basically stuck together for the first few miles and we all ran Lone Tree Hill.  My endurance felt great all day long, but my fitness was off.  That climb up the hill took it out of me.  I don't think I ever recovered from it.  However, I continued to push through the switchbacks.  Dorsimus was on my heels the whole way so he really kept me moving.

Once I hit the top of the switchbacks though, I had something happen that I've never experienced while running before... cramps!  Now I completely understand why it's such a big deal when people encounter them while running.  It was no fun, but it only happened a couple times on the way back.

Once we reached Elephant Head I said goodbye to the boys (who went on to finish their 50K) and I headed back to the car.  I took it nice and easy on the way back and just enjoyed being able to run again.  I love running out on the island.

I'm really proud of myself for knowing my limits today and sticking to it.  I wanted so badly to put in some more miles with the fellas, but I knew it probably wasn't a smart idea.  Looking forward to easing back into training the next couple weeks before ramping back up to where I should be right now.
